Output d6593651ef81e3b291154aa5fdb79028221d2097d77ca3f93727033d0fe1af59:2

value
1283134
script pubkey
OP_0 OP_PUSHBYTES_20 85762abc5d5f056a7a23c4126cda4e4c587b180a
address
bc1qs4mz40zatuzk573rcsfxekjwf3v8kxq2vg2wld
transaction
d6593651ef81e3b291154aa5fdb79028221d2097d77ca3f93727033d0fe1af59
spent
true